Mdx parameter which is not declared




















Next, create a Dataset and for this example you can call it CategorySales this Dataset should use the Adventure Works cube data source. Select Query Designer and click the Design Mode button to begin writing your query. Use the following query to return back results without a parameter:. All this query did was returned back the total sales, but this is useless for a report by itself.

If we were to do this normally in MDX it would look something like this:. They not only want to see the list of product category sales, but they also want it made into a parameter so they can select from a dropdown box the category or categories they wish to view. To do this, first create the parameter by selecting the Query Parameters button. After you hit OK to confirm the Query Parameter screen you will need to modify your MDX to take advantage of the parameter you have created.

Here we use StrToSet to convert whatever is brought in from the parameter values selected by the end users to something MDX can understand. The Constrained flag here just ensures that parameter provides a member name in the set. Hit OK twice to confirm the query so far and make a simple tabular report to view your results so far.

You will notice that a dropdown box parameter was automatically created for the ProductCategory parameter we defined.

You may already be familiar with this if you have ever used the drag and drop interface for making parameters. Viewed 7k times. Improve this question. Add a comment. Active Oldest Votes.

Improve this answer. Manoj Attal 2, 3 3 gold badges 26 26 silver badges 31 31 bronze badges. Christopher Scott Christopher Scott 1, 1 1 gold badge 17 17 silver badges 21 21 bronze badges. I've declared the parameter in the Dataset Properties window, but I still having the same issue.

This fixed it for me and not only that, after I managed to refresh the fields I noted a field name was changed which solved another issue I was having.

This should be the answer. Is the parameter defined at the report level? That might be what's missing. Sign up or log in Sign up using Google. Sign up using Facebook. Two extra points I needed to resolve were:. I have a list of employee names in my parameter dropdown populated using a query.

I want to pass the parameter value selected by user to the main MDX query that pulls all the data points. Would you be able to plaease share step by step process with screenshots and syntex. Power BI. Turn on suggestions.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. Showing results for. Search instead for. Did you mean:. All forum topics Previous Topic Next Topic. Passing parameters to MDX source queries.

Something like I'm most interested in required settings on the parameter and any syntax requirements for the Query Refresh to detect and apply a defined Power BI parameter Thanks Solved!

Labels: Labels: Need Help. Message 1 of 5. Message 2 of 5. In response to v-shex-msft. Message 3 of 5. I'm not sure that the next workaround will be fine for your requirements.

We create an excel file in order to insert the filters values. For instance if you want to filter some years and we create a table into excel that contains that values.



0コメント

  • 1000 / 1000